Description

As-Is. This Home/Rental Multi-Family is an end unit. The upper apartment has seperate entrance in front of home, 2beds 1full bath a large eat-in kitchen. The lower level apartment entrance is on the side of the home, eat-in kitchen, full bath, two bedrooms or one bedroom and family room with fireplace.
